Re: Upgrade fails, include/db/config.php does not exists
« Reply #12 on: February 04, 2012, 12:25:32 am »

Please check your database configuration in include/db/config.php
It would be looking for the file:  your_cpg_root/include/config.inc.php
That is one of the files that you should have a backup of.
You can enter / edit the db settings into config.inc.php.sample that is in the same directory if you have no backup copy.
It explains itself.

The database is runing and the config file is the one uset by Phorum5
No, Coppermine reads db information from  config.inc.php.
